Transaction 31c5dca0176cc9005be75cf633eade39dc23dca81776074f749fce5c433d37c2

1 Input
2 Outputs
  • 31c5dca0176cc9005be75cf633eade39dc23dca81776074f749fce5c433d37c2:0
  • value  62746176
    address  3Qzroyq7zG3pUr3g6UMZo5CijLDyAii8WG
  • 31c5dca0176cc9005be75cf633eade39dc23dca81776074f749fce5c433d37c2:1
  • value  126632
    address  3GSobSAodkxYxLXDa7ZpkBT5PvUmvVJtNT